site stats

Oracle create table as select primary key

WebTo create a PRIMARY KEY constraint on the "ID" column when the table is already created, use the following SQL: MySQL / SQL Server / Oracle / MS Access: ALTER TABLE Persons ADD PRIMARY KEY (ID); To allow naming of a PRIMARY KEY constraint, and for defining a PRIMARY KEY constraint on multiple columns, use the following SQL syntax: WebOct 15, 2024 · You can also create a table based on a select statement. This makes a table with the same columns and rows as the source query. This operation is known as create-table-as-select (CTAS). This is a handy way to copy one table to another. For example, the following creates toys_clone from toys: Copy code snippet

Oracle / PLSQL: Primary Keys - TechOnTheNet

WebYou can create one table from another by adding a SELECT statement at the end of the CREATE TABLE statement: CREATE TABLE new_tbl [AS] SELECT * FROM orig_tbl;. MySQL creates new columns for all elements in the SELECT.For example: mysql> CREATE TABLE test (a INT NOT NULL AUTO_INCREMENT, -> PRIMARY KEY (a), KEY(b)) -> … Web-- create a new table using all the columns and data types -- from an existing table: CREATE TABLE T3 AS SELECT * FROM T1 WITH NO DATA; -- create a new table, providing new … black friday mediaworld 2022 https://nakytech.com

Creating Tables - Oracle

WebIn a multi-table index cluster, related table rows are grouped together to reduce disk I/O. For example, assume that you have a customer and orders table and 95% of the access is to select all orders for a particular customer. Oracle will have to perform an I/O to fetch the customer row and then multiple I/Os to fetch each order for the customer. http://www.dba-oracle.com/oracle_tip_hash_index_cluster_table.htm WebMay 17, 2012 · use the Oracle metatable (select dbms_metadata.get_ddl ('TABLE','SCHEMANAME','TABLENAME') DDL from dual; This works will except, if you have primary keys, contraints, etc. With Oracle 12.2 or your mirroring a table on a remote database using a database link. black friday media markt schweiz

Oracle Identity Column: A Step-by-Step Guide with Examples

Category:Oracle Identity Column: A Step-by-Step Guide with Examples

Tags:Oracle create table as select primary key

Oracle create table as select primary key

Oracle Identity Column: A Step-by-Step Guide with Examples

WebSep 3, 2001 · Create table template: 2. Create table with data type: VARCHAR2, Date, Number(8,2) 3. Using a CREATE TABLE statement: create a table with primary key: 4. … http://www.java2s.com/Code/Oracle/Table/createasselectthenaddprimarykey.htm

Oracle create table as select primary key

Did you know?

WebOct 21, 2009 · create table test1_temp as select * from test1 where 1=2; The table was created w/o data. But the problem is that the indexes and primary key of table "test1" are not copied to "test1_temp". Since the table ddl is copied dynamically, I want to copy the indexes and primary keys also dynamically. How should I achieve this. Pls help.Thanks. WebAnswer: To do this, the SQL CREATE TABLE syntax is: CREATE TABLE new_table AS (SELECT * FROM old_table WHERE 1=2); For example: CREATE TABLE suppliers AS (SELECT * FROM companies WHERE 1=2); This would create a new table called suppliers that included all columns from the companies table, but no data from the companies table.

WebApr 19, 2010 · Using GUIDs as primary keys Hello Tom,I have a question on using GUIDs as primary keys. Our application is being developed on 11gR2 with a 3-node RAC. The development team has introduced a new column to almost all of the tables which is technically a UUID generated by the application code. They are also indexing it. The reas

WebThe CREATE TABLE AS statement is used to create a table from an existing table by copying the columns of existing table. Note: If you create the table in this way, the new table will contain records from the existing table. Syntax: CREATE TABLE new_table AS (SELECT * FROM old_table); Create Table Example: copying all columns of another table WebThe table should have at least 4 columns and 1 primary key. Insert 4 records into the table. Create a screenshot of a successful SELECT statement against this table and post the …

WebFor the purposes of creating a unique primary key for a new table, first we must CREATE the table we’ll be using: CREATE TABLE books ( id NUMBER(10) NOT NULL, title VARCHAR2(100) NOT NULL ); Next we need to add a PRIMARY KEY constraint: ALTER TABLE books ADD ( CONSTRAINT books_pk PRIMARY KEY (id) );

WebDec 4, 2024 · Here we are creating the table TEST3 with same structure as TEST but without any data When you are creating table as select , you can create the primary key also … black friday mediaworld 2022 dateWebFeb 21, 2024 · 2. Next, right-click on the column name and select the set primary key option. 3. This will make a change, and a key will appear beside the column, confirming that the column is now a primary key column. Creating a Primary Key in SQL Using Code. You can create a primary key column in a table using the primary key constraint. CREATE TABLE … black friday mediaworld volantinoWebJan 5, 2024 · Example of create table with primary key (Oracle / SQL Server) : The table named STUDENT_primary is created with Rollno as primary key constraint. If user want to … games coming out april 2016Web1.primary key :主键约束(非空,唯一) 2.foreign key :外键约束 (受另一张表的主键的约束) 3.check :检查约束--要么约束的值或者是空值 4.unique :唯一约束--不重复,可以有多 … games coming out 2021WebTo create a new table with a column defined as the primary key, you can use the keyword PRIMARY KEY at the end of the definition of that column. In our example, we create the … games coming out christmas 2021WebOct 21, 2009 · create table test1_temp as select * from test1 where 1=2; The table was created w/o data. But the problem is that the indexes and primary key of table "test1" are … games coming in octoberWebserver, sql tutorials, oracle dba tutorials, sql expert, sql tutorials for beginners, foreign keys, how to, how to add primary key, primar... games.com download